Hitler's 3-mile-long abandoned Nazi resort is transforming into a luxury getaway

In 1939, Adolf Hitler ordered the construction of a massive 3-mile-long row of buildings, destined to be an enormous beach resort for Nazi Germany. It was abandoned three years later, when World War II broke out. It would sit empty for the next 75 years. Today, German real estate company Metropole Marketing plans to convert several blocks into luxury homes and hotels.
